What Key Features Should Youth Players Look for in an All-Around Baseball Glove?

Youth players should look for specific key features when selecting an all-around baseball glove to ensure it meets their needs effectively.

  1. Size and Fit
  2. Material Quality
  3. Web Style
  4. Padding and Comfort
  5. Versatility
  6. Break-in Time
  7. Price Point

Considering these features varies among different players based on their position, age, and personal preferences. Some players might prioritize material quality for durability, while others may focus on the glove’s size for comfort and fit.

  1. Size and Fit:
    Size and fit refer to the glove’s dimensions in relation to the youth player’s hand. Proper fit enhances control and comfort. Youth gloves typically range from 9 to 12 inches. For instance, a 10-inch glove is ideal for infield positions, while an 11.5-inch model suits outfielders better. A glove that is too large can hinder performance, while one that is too small may restrict movement.

  2. Material Quality:
    Material quality encompasses the type of leather or synthetic materials used in construction. High-quality leather provides durability and a better feel, while synthetic materials can be lighter and easier to break in. For example, a premium steerhide glove can last longer than a basic synthetic glove but may require a longer break-in period.

  3. Web Style:
    Web style refers to the design of the glove’s webbing that connects the thumb and the fingers. Different web styles serve varied purposes. For example, an I-web design is better for infielders, as it allows for quicker ball transfers, while a closed web is preferable for pitchers to conceal the ball.

  4. Padding and Comfort:
    Padding and comfort determine how the glove absorbs impact and provides support to the player’s hand. Adequate padding can prevent injury and improve hand comfort during play. Gloves with additional padding in the palm can lessen the sting of hard hits.

  5. Versatility:
    Versatility indicates how well a glove can perform in multiple positions. Some gloves feature designs that cater to different roles, such as infield, outfield, and catching. A versatile glove can save parents money as one glove can accommodate various positions throughout the season.

  6. Break-in Time:
    Break-in time measures how much effort is required to soften and mold the glove to the player’s hand. Some gloves are game-ready with minimal break-in, while others may require significant time and effort. A glove requiring extensive break-in might not be ideal for a player needing immediate performance.

  7. Price Point:
    Price point refers to the cost of the glove and its value relative to its features. Youth players may prefer budget-friendly options that don’t compromise on quality. Investing in a mid-range glove can be beneficial for serious players who engage in regular practice and games.

Evaluating these features will help youth players choose the best all-around baseball glove to enhance their gameplay experience.

What Steps Should Youth Players Take to Maintain Their Baseball Gloves?

To maintain their baseball gloves, youth players should follow specific care steps. Consistent maintenance helps enhance the glove’s lifespan and performance on the field.

  1. Clean the glove regularly.
  2. Condition the leather.
  3. Store the glove properly.
  4. Avoid excessive moisture.
  5. Use a glove mallet for shaping.
  6. Break in the glove gradually.
  7. Repair any damage promptly.

Taking care of a baseball glove is crucial for both performance and longevity. Each maintenance step carries significance and can impact the glove’s condition over time.

  1. Cleaning the Glove Regularly:
    Cleaning the glove regularly involves removing dirt and debris. Youth players can use a damp cloth to wipe down the glove’s surface. Mild soap and water can also help eliminate tough stains. It’s recommended to clean the glove after every few games to keep it in good shape.

  2. Conditioning the Leather:
    Conditioning the leather keeps it soft and prevents cracks. Players should use a leather conditioner specifically designed for baseball gloves. Applying a thin layer of conditioner every few months is advisable, especially in dry climates. The conditioner replenishes oils that keep the leather supple.

  3. Storing the Glove Properly:
    Storing the glove properly is vital for maintaining its shape and avoiding damage. Players should keep the glove in a cool, dry place when not in use. It’s helpful to insert a ball into the glove and tie it closed to help maintain its form during storage.

  4. Avoiding Excessive Moisture:
    Excessive moisture can damage the leather and shape of the glove. Players should avoid leaving their glove in damp areas or near water. If the glove gets wet, it should be air-dried at room temperature and never placed near a heat source to prevent cracking.

  5. Using a Glove Mallet for Shaping:
    Using a glove mallet helps players shape their glove effectively. A glove mallet can provide the necessary force to break in new leather without causing damage. It is particularly useful for getting the pocket just right.

  6. Breaking in the Glove Gradually:
    Breaking in the glove gradually allows for a natural fit. Players should practice using the glove over time rather than forcing it into shape immediately. This can prevent stiffness and ensure the glove conforms to the player’s hand.

  7. Repairing Any Damage Promptly:
    Repairing any damage promptly prevents further issues. Players should inspect their gloves regularly for rips, loose stitching, or broken laces. Quick repairs can often be handled at home, but severe damage may require professional assistance.
